Lind Honda Player of the Month

Adam Lind has been named the Honda Player of  Month for September by the Toronto Chapter of the BBWAA.  Honda, the official vehicle of the Blue Jays, makes a donation to the charity of the player of the month’s choice.             Lind had a hot last month of the season batting .339 (22-68) while ranking tied for first in home runs with […]
